However Journalism and english hons are totally different streams of study, you can also pursue each other by being in separate streams. however journalism is a totally professional course and would lead to a career in journalism and media and through eng hons you can join academia, and many other diverse career options including journalism by taking up a diploma later. However choose whatever you feel you are inclined to. Journalism being a professional course has better employability options just after graduation.

Hello Aspirant, Amity School of Film and Drama (ASFD) offers globally benchmarked training in Acting, Script Writing, Film Production, Film Direction, Cinematography, Video Editing, Theatre, Stage Craft and Stage Direction.
They have separate film making studio in which they perform all practicals.
